The skills section of your resume should include details of technologies that you at least have a working knowledge of. It should also include any notable soft skills you have, such as presenting to large groups or writing technical information for a non-technical audience. The skills listed in this section should be verifiable. List your technical abilities in a skills bank. Unless you’re applying for an executive position, a key skills section is a must in technical fields. List your skills in a bank for quick reference (and to generate ATS hits), then detail how you’ve put them to use in your experience section.
